Wallander: The Joker (2006) — A Child's Witness to Murder in a Gripping Crime Thriller

In the gripping crime thriller Wallander: The Joker (2006), directed by Stephan Apelgren, Detective Kurt Wallander faces a chilling investigation after a brutal murder rocks a small Swedish town. A woman is stabbed to death outside her restaurant in broad daylight, her eight-year-old daughter the sole witness to the horrific act. As Wallander and his dedicated team dig deeper, they uncover unsettling ties to a shadowy restaurant mafia operating behind the city's polished façade. The film masterfully blends suspense with raw emotional intensity, capturing the gritty realities of Swedish crime-solving while exploring themes of justice, fear, and the fragility of innocence.

With a runtime of just 88 minutes, Wallander: The Joker delivers a tight, suspenseful narrative packed with sharp character dynamics. Krister Henriksson delivers a standout performance as the weary but determined Wallander, supported by a stellar cast including Johanna Sällström, Ola Rapace, and Fredrik Gunnarsson. Apelgren's direction keeps the tension palpable, making this a must-watch for fans of Scandinavian noir and police procedurals alike.
